Output 8097635c90945919c538dc32b5763497ee5aaa07171fa311c69bd852c5cce5a1:1

value
105500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e91e8e76b0b053a7af3b8d22a67e928ec54145 OP_EQUAL
address
3MC57pZV35XgB2dN2Pe1tLnXCdTjHcZtAe
transaction
8097635c90945919c538dc32b5763497ee5aaa07171fa311c69bd852c5cce5a1
spent
true